The ASTM A240/A240M standard applies to chromium, chromium-nickel, and chromium-manganese-nickel stainless steel plates, strips, and coils intended for use in pressure vessels and general-purpose applications. 316Ti (UNS S31635, EN 1.4571) is one such titanium-stabilized austenitic stainless steel, specifically designed for high-temperature, highly corrosive environments.

Chemical Composition of ASTM A240 316Ti Stainless Steel Plate

 

 

The chemical composition of ASTM A240 316Ti Stainless Steel Sheet & Plate is carefully controlled to ensure excellent corrosion resistance, oxidation resistance, and high-temperature strength.
 

Element Content (%)
Carbon (C) ≤0.08
Silicon (Si) ≤1.00
Manganese (Mn) ≤2.00
Phosphorus (P) ≤0.045
Sulfur (S) ≤0.030
Chromium (Cr) 16.0–18.0
Nickel (Ni) 10.0–14.0
Molybdenum (Mo) 2.0–3.0
Titanium (Ti) ≥5×C and ≤0.70
Nitrogen (N) ≤0.10

 
 

Physical Properties of 316Ti Hot Rolled Stainless Steel Plate

 

 

Property Value
Density 8.0 g/cm³
Melting Range 1370–1400°C
Thermal Conductivity (100°C) 16.3 W/m·K
Electrical Resistivity 0.74 μΩ·m
Specific Heat 500 J/kg·K
Modulus of Elasticity 193 GPa

The 316Ti Hot Rolled Stainless Steel Plate maintains excellent dimensional stability and mechanical integrity under both high-temperature and corrosive service conditions.
 

Mechanical Properties of ASTM A240 UNS S31635 Plate

 

 

Property Value
Tensile Strength ≥515 MPa
Yield Strength (0.2%) ≥205 MPa
Elongation ≥40%
Hardness ≤217 HB
Reduction of Area ≥50%

The ASTM A240 316Ti Stainless Steel Plate provides an excellent balance of strength, ductility, and toughness, making it suitable for fabrication, welding, and long-term industrial service.
 

Corrosion Resistance of 316Ti Stainless Steel Plate

 

 

The addition of titanium improves resistance to intergranular corrosion after welding while maintaining excellent resistance to:

Chloride environments

Organic and inorganic acids

Chemical processing media

Seawater splash zones

High-temperature oxidation

Stress corrosion cracking (better than many conventional austenitic grades in specific conditions)

These characteristics make UNS S31635 / EN 1.4571 Stainless Steel Plate an ideal material for petrochemical and marine industries.

2. What is the difference between 316 and 316Ti stainless steel?

The primary difference is the addition of titanium in 316Ti Stainless Steel. Titanium helps prevent carbide precipitation during welding, providing better resistance to intergranular corrosion and making 316Ti more suitable for prolonged service at elevated temperatures.

3. What does UNS S31635 and EN 1.4571 mean?

UNS S31635 is the Unified Numbering System designation used in North America, while EN 1.4571 is the European material number. Both refer to the internationally recognized 316Ti stainless steel grade.

4. What surface finish is available for hot rolled 316Ti stainless steel plates?

The standard finish is No.1 Finish, produced through hot rolling, annealing, and pickling. Additional finishes and custom processing are available based on project requirements.
